DAC3482 Dual-Channel DACs

Texas Instruments offers the DAC3482 dual-channel, 16-bit, 1.25 GSPS, 2x to 16x interpolating digital-to-analog converters (DACs)

Image of Texas Instruments' DAC3482 Dual-Channel DACsTexas Instruments' DAC3482 is a very low power, high dynamic range, dual-channel, 16-bit digital-to-analog converter (DAC) with a sample rate as high as 1.25 GSPS.

The device includes features that simplify the design of complex transmit architectures: 2x to 16x digital interpolation filters with over 90 dB of stop-band attenuation simplify the data interface and reconstruction filters. A complex mixer allows flexible carrier placement. A high-performance low jitter clock multiplier simplifies clocking of the device without significant impact on the dynamic range. The digital quadrature modulator correction (QMC) enables complete IQ compensation for gain, offset, phase, and group delay between channels in direct up-conversion applications.

Digital data is input to the device through a flexible LVDS data bus with on-chip termination. Data can be input either word-wide or byte-wide. The device includes a FIFO, data pattern checker, and parity test to ease the input interface. The interface also allows full synchronization of multiple devices.

The device is characterized for operation over the entire industrial temperature range of -40°C to +85°C and is available in a very small 88-pin 9 mm x 9 mm WQFN-MR package or 196-ball 12 mm x 12 mm NFBGA package.

Very low power, small size, superior crosstalk, high dynamic range, and features of the DAC3482 make it an ideal fit for today’s communication systems.

Features
  • Very low power: 900 mW at 1.25 GSPS, full operating conditions
  • Multi-DAC synchronization
  • Selectable 2x, 4x, 8x, 16x interpolation filter
    • Stop-band attenuation > 90 dBc
  • Flexible on-chip complex mixing
    • Fine mixer with 32-bit NCO
    • Power saving coarse mixer: ± n×Fs/8
  • High performance, low jitter clock multiplying PLL
  • Digital I and Q correction
  • Gain, phase, offset, and group delay correction

Applications

  • Cellular base stations
  • Diversity transmit
  • Wideband communications
  • Digital inverse sync filter
  • Flexible LVDS input data bus
    • Word- or byte-wide interface
    • Eight sample input FIFO
    • Data pattern checker
    • Parity check
  • Temperature sensor
  • Differential scalable output: 10 mA to 30 mA
  • Multiple package options: 88-pin 9 mm x 9 mm WQFN-MR and 196-ball 12 mm x 12 mm NFBGA (GREEN / Pb-free)
